Stilbene oligomers in roots of Sophora davidii.

T Tanaka1, T Ito, M Iinuma, M Ohyama, M Ichise, Y Tateishi.   

Abstract

Three stilbene oligomers, davidiols A-C were isolated from the roots of Sophora davidii in addition to the seven known phenols, leachianone A, sophoraflavanones G, H and I, miyabenol C, alpha-viniferin and epsilon-viniferin. Their structures and relative configurations were established by means of 2D-NMR spectroscopy including COLOC and PSNOESY.
